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our team will arrive at your property, assess the damage, and find out the best course of action to contain the affected area. We’ll use specialized equipment to seal off the area and prevent further water damage. Our goal is to reduce the risk of secondary damage and prevent mold growth.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using our specialized equipment, we’ll extract the water from your property, including the affected area, walls, and floors. Our technicians will work efficiently to remove as much water as possible, ensuring that your property is dry and safe.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been extracted, we’ll use our state-of-the-art drying equipment to dry out your property. Our technicians will monitor the moisture levels to ensure that your property is completely dry and safe.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
After the drying process is complete, our team will clean and sanitize the affected area to prevent mold growth and ensure a healthy environment. We’ll use specialized cleaning solutions to remove any dirt, grime, or bacteria that may have accumulated.
Step 5: Restoration and Repairs
Once the cleaning and sanitizing process is complete, our team will work with you to restore your property to its original condition. We’ll repair any damaged walls, floors, or ceilings, and ensure that your property is safe and secure.

Q: Can I prevent frozen pipes from bursting?
A: Yes, there are several steps you can take to prevent frozen pipes from bursting, including insulating exposed pipes, letting cold water drip from the faucet served by exposed pipes, and keeping your home warm during extremely cold weather.
